About This Item

New York: Knopf, 1991. Book. Very Good+. Hardcover. 1st Edition. 8vo - over 7¾ - 9¾" tall. Hardcover in publisher's non price-clipped dust-jacket. 318 pages. Bibliographical Notes, Index. Stated first edition. A thought provoking biography of the great explorer, delving into questions long ignored by many previous biographers. No previous ownership marks. A clean, square, fresh and unmarked copy. Very good+ in a very good+ dust-jacket. .
